摘要: 以大鼠肝细胞为研究对象,研究乙草胺对大鼠肝细胞G蛋白偶联受体介导胞浆钙振荡的调控。结果表明,单独乙草胺刺激不引发胞浆钙离子振荡,乙草胺和PE同时作用对肾上腺素能受体有抑制作用且具有明显的量效反应关系。

Abstract: The effects of different concentrations of acetochlor on the regulation of cytosolic calcium oscillation induced by G protein-coupled receptors in rat hepatocytes was investigated. The results showed that acetochlor and PE could inhibit PE receptors which the effect of acetochlor on it were dose-dependent, and acetochlor alone had no effect on PE receptors.
